Did you create a backup when you first rooted? If not, then you will not have one there. You will have to flash a custom rom or the stock rom if its available to get back to a working KF.
 
I believe that this thread has the rooted stock rom that comes on the KF. You will have to reinstall any mods(Go launcher and such) that you had previously but it should get you back to a working device.

You can install a pre-rooted version of the new Kindle OS 6.3, if you are on 6.2.2, with only TWRP or CWM available. You don't need ADB or fastboot. This can fix a corrupted 6.2.2 OS. It will preserve your apps, and it will preserve your current recovery and bootloader.

Basically, you go into TWRP and enable "mount USB storage" and simply copy the 6.3 zip to your internal memory from your PC. Then use TWRP to flash the zip you installed. NOT the stock 6.3 zip, but the pre-rooted version I refer to in the link above. Or go there directly from here: http://forum.xda-developers.com/showthread.php?t=1569298

The 6.3 Kindle version has some relevant improvements. You'll probably get it OTA anyway, and you'll lose root. Be proactive and install it first with root.

If you go into TWRP and mount as usb storage, it should come up on your pc as a removable storage device and not as the KF. You should then be able to copy the zip file to the "sdcard" partition on the KF. Unmount usb storage, wipe and flash the zip. You should end up with a bootable device at that point.
